If your looking to have MORE GRIP, and some protection from falls, this is the case to get.
It has a nice rubber, not too sticky feel to it. ITs just right for your pockets and holding in your hand while you type. The corners, as you can see have extra padding, because thats where we always drop the phone....So its safe, but if your looking for an ULTRA safe, ULTIMATE protection, go with the Otterbox commuter. |

Well, here's what you can expect from this purchase. For starters, this case is NOT A HARDCASE AND DOES NOT WATERPROOF YOUR PHONE. That said, it does add a certain ruggedness to your phone and does, at least for me, give some peace of mind as to surviving random drops on the floor. I'd say you could drop it a good 4ft or so and be just fine. The corners of the case have the extra insulation which would help with drops, as well as the slightly protruding backside. In addition to that, the case is light -- since it is basically a rubber case, and comes with a perfectly cut screen protector for the phone. (Gotta protect that screen, too!) Overall, I consider this to be a bargain purchase, all things considered, and a solid entry-level case for an entry-level Blackberry. To add context, I paid $12.99 the day of my phone purchase for a BASIC soft plastic case at the store, while this OtterBox is two bucks more and comes with a screen protector and more shock protection.
